full-text-search

There are 378 repositories under full-text-search topic.

  • meilisearch

    meilisearch/meilisearch

    A lightning-fast search API that fits effortlessly into your apps, websites, and workflow

    Language:Rust48.3k2872k1.9k
  • typesense/typesense

    Open Source alternative to Algolia + Pinecone and an Easier-to-Use alternative to ElasticSearch ⚡ 🔍 ✨ Fast, typo tolerant, in-memory fuzzy Search Engine for building delightful search experiences

    Language:C++21.6k1301.5k668
  • flexsearch

    nextapps-de/flexsearch

    Next-Generation full text search library for Browser and Node.js

    Language:JavaScript12.6k102323493
  • manticoresearch

    manticoresoftware/manticoresearch

    Easy to use open source fast database for search | Good alternative to Elasticsearch now | Drop-in replacement for E in the ELK soon

    Language:C++9.2k1111.9k510
  • olivernn/lunr.js

    A bit like Solr, but much smaller and not as bright

    Language:JavaScript9k121395551
  • paradedb/paradedb

    Postgres for Search and Analytics

    Language:Rust6.3k36486192
  • jonaswinkler/paperless-ng

    A supercharged version of paperless: scan, index and archive all your physical documents

    Language:Python5.4k53671353
  • WorldBrain/Memex

    Browser extension to curate, annotate, and discuss the most valuable content and ideas on the web. As individuals, teams and communities.

    Language:TypeScript4.4k69598342
  • tntsearch

    teamtnt/tntsearch

    A fully featured full text search engine written in PHP

    Language:PHP3.1k96226292
  • infiniflow/infinity

    The AI-native database built for LLM applications, providing incredibly fast hybrid search of dense vector, sparse vector, tensor (multi-vector), and full-text

    Language:C++2.8k32461279
  • usearch

    unum-cloud/usearch

    Fast Open-Source Search & Clustering engine × for Vectors & 🔜 Strings × in C++, C, Python, JavaScript, Rust, Java, Objective-C, Swift, C#, GoLang, and Wolfram 🔍

    Language:C++2.3k29169150
  • radondb/radon

    RadonDB is an open source, cloud-native MySQL database for building global, scalable cloud services

    Language:Go1.8k88298217
  • NotJoeMartinez/yt-fts

    YouTube Full Text Search - Search all of a YouTube channel from the command line

    Language:Python1.6k128882
  • monocle

    thesephist/monocle

    Universal personal search engine, powered by a full text search algorithm written in pure Ink, indexing Linus's blogs and private note archives, contacts, tweets, and over a decade of journals.

    Language:JavaScript1.5k25436
  • SeekStorm/SeekStorm

    SeekStorm - sub-millisecond full-text search library & multi-tenancy server in Rust

    Language:Rust1.4k6637
  • coleifer/walrus

    Lightweight Python utilities for working with Redis

    Language:Python1.2k2716692
  • codelibs/fess

    Fess is very powerful and easily deployable Enterprise Search Server.

    Language:Java1k642.6k167
  • groonga/groonga

    An embeddable fulltext search engine. Groonga is the successor project to Senna.

    Language:C80369595117
  • PrithivirajDamodaran/FlashRank

    Lite & Super-fast re-ranking for your search & retrieval pipelines. Supports SoTA Listwise and Pairwise reranking based on LLMs and cross-encoders and more. Created by Prithivi Da, open for PRs & Collaborations.

    Language:Python69472651
  • lionsoul2014/friso

    High performance Chinese tokenizer with both GBK and UTF-8 charset support based on MMSEG algorithm developed by ANSI C. Completely based on modular implementation and can be easily embedded in other programs, like: MySQL, PostgreSQL, PHP, etc.

    Language:C485332093
  • askaitools/askaitools-community-edition

    A cutting-edge search engine project tailored specifically for the AI product

    Language:TypeScript3411229
  • coleifer/scout

    RESTful search server written in Python, powered by SQLite.

    Language:Python3059826
  • ekzhang/classes.wtf

    A course catalog with extremely fast full-text search

    Language:Go2998918
  • auula/typikon

    Typikon lets you use markdown to write your online books.

    Language:Rust290239
  • koniu/recoll-webui

    web interface for recoll desktop search

    Language:Python279147055
  • iboxdb/ftserver

    Full Text Search Engine Server for Java, Lightweight embeddable, powered by iBoxDB.

    Language:Java25142073
  • heywhy/ex_elasticlunr

    Elasticlunr is a small, full-text search library for use in the Elixir environment. It indexes JSON documents and provides a friendly search interface to retrieve documents.

    Language:Elixir19012810
  • mikegoatly/lifti

    A lightweight full text indexer for .NET

    Language:C#1865769
  • ForetagInc/alchemy

    Archived - High performance, realtime BaaS with RBAC, graphing, full text search, S3 / B2 Storage and GIS with a GraphQL, gRPC and REST API

    Language:Rust167462
  • thesephist/libsearch

    Simple, index-free full-text search for JavaScript

    Language:JavaScript163413
  • pmatseykanets/laravel-scout-postgres

    PostgreSQL Full Text Search Engine for Laravel Scout

    Language:PHP16152439
  • alash3al/srchx

    A standalone lightweight full-text search engine built on top of blevesearch and Go with multiple storage (scorch, boltdb, leveldb, badger)

    Language:Go1599412
  • madneal/everywhere

    :wrench: A tool can really search everywhere for you.

    Language:Java1598521
  • realTristan/hermes

    Extremely Fast Full-Text-Search Algorithm and Caching System

    Language:Go154325
  • localvoid/ndx

    :mag: Full text indexing and searching library

    Language:TypeScript1539811
  • Link-/starred_search

    Search your starred ★ repositories on GitHub from your terminal

    Language:JavaScript138581